Cherry Tree Removal in Allentown, PA
Cherry tree removal services involve the careful and efficient removal of cherry trees from residential or commercial properties. This service is often requested for reasons such as tree health concerns, safety issues due to overgrown or damaged branches, or to clear space for new landscaping projects.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the removal process, including whether stump grinding or debris cleanup is included, and how the work may impact the surrounding landscape. It’s also important to consider factors like tree size, location, and any potential permits or regulations that may apply before proceeding with removal.
Homeowners and property owners usually seek information about the safety and methods used during cherry tree removal, especially when trees are located near structures, power lines, or other trees. Understanding the potential for damage to nearby plants or property, as well as the disposal or recycling of tree debris, helps in making informed decisions. Clarifying these details in advance can ensure the removal process aligns with property maintenance goals and minimizes disruption to the landscape.
